Truck fire on State Highway 33

UPDATED 11.25am: A truck driver has had a lucky escape after the cab of his truck and trailer unit went up in flames on State Highway 33, south of Paengaroa this morning.

The truck unit, carrying fertiliser, caught alight on the roadside north of Sun Valley Station, between Paengaroa and Rotorua at about 9.45am.


The truck was "well involved" when fire services arrived on the scene. Photos: Bruce Barnard.

Maketu Fire Brigade station officer Shane Gourlay says the truck's cab was 'well involved” on the road side when firefighters from Maketu and Te Puke arrived on the scene.

'It was well involved but contained to the cab,” says Shane. 'The top of the truck canopy was burnt.”

Working quickly, they managed to contain the fire to the cab in about five-to-eight minutes.

The driver was out of the truck when they arrived.

As a safety precaution, the HAZMAT unit from Greerton was also called.

Traffic was directed slowly past the area while firefighters and police dealt with the incident.
